About the DCCC:
The DCCC is the official national Democratic campaign committee charged with electing Democrats to the U. S. House of Representatives. The DCCC recruits Democratic candidates and supports Democratic campaigns – both challengers and Democratic incumbent Members – with a variety of services including field operations, fundraising support, communications assistance, research support and management consulting. In addition, the DCCC’s Independent Expenditure supports these campaigns with television, radio and other voter contact efforts. The DCCC is supported by the contributions of individuals and organizations, along with Democratic Members, from throughout the country. Position Summary:
The Digital Strategist is responsible for the writing, loading, and sending of supporter emails and text messages, building and maintaining petition and donation pages, and posting content to social networks. This position will assist the team in developing strategic digital fundraising campaigns. In addition, this position will assist in maintaining digital advertising programs and campaigns. Applicants should be creative, hardworking, and passionate about Democratic campaigns. This is not a traditional 9-5 role. Evening and weekend work will be expected from time to time.
